Congratulations to Mr Duckworth for his EFL debut but personally that is not a game that should be being used as a trial game. A team scrapping for their future in the EFL vs a team, ableit basically there, still looking to acheive promotion. I know that it should be a formality but that shouldnt be a factor in appointments. There are other games in league 2 this weekend that would have been more suited to trial a referee.

Im all for this new system of trialling referees all through the season but some of the games being selected could really backfire. Its not the first time this season an important game has been used as a trial match either, Scott Oldham in the championship for Sunderland vs Luton springs to mind. For referees on the NL already how must they feel when a game with something riding on it is given to a lower level referee and they are left to pad fixture list out so to speak.

Afraid on this showing, it may be time for Mr Boyeson to think about hanging up his whistle. Nearly all of the cards came in the second half, things coming to a head after a Colchester forward was booked for a dive in a penalty shout. That no penalty call was from the AR and after a conversation with his colleague, he then decided to issue a YC. A few minutes later he did award a penalty to the home side, booking two Rovers players in the process and from there on it seemed like a card for every foul. One, for Rovers forward Harvey Saunders, who fell in the box after a clear shirt tug, with Mr Boyeson well behind the action and the AR on the opposite side of the pitch looked plain wrong.
